Ben Slinger

Age: 20

Where were you born?
I was born in Lancaster, England.

Where do you live now?
I still live in Lancaster, I can't complain though! There's lots of places to train in this area.

How long have you been riding trials?
I started riding trials back in 2000, which is 9 years now!

How did you get into trials?

I got into trials after watching some local riders trying to get up walls and benches, I joined in and after 2 years I started competing.

What is your best achievement to date?

Back in 2005 I became both Junior 20" and 26" World Champion, that's two competitions on two different sized bikes in the same day! I am the first person ever to do this from the UK.

What are your goals in 2008?

I would like to come in the top 8 in the Elite World championship, Elite is everyone over 19 competing in the same category. I would also like to do more displays in schools to try and involve new young riders to the sport.

Who are your most influential riders?
I love to watch Giacomo Coustellier, a former Elite World champion. He has such a smooth flowing style.

Where is your favourite place to ride?
I think my favourite place of all time would have to be Buthiers, France. Located South of Paris near Fontainbleu. There are thousands of huge boulders which makes for an amazing training area.
